Which of the following is considered a violation of traffic control?

Explanation:
Driving over the speed limit is considered a violation of traffic control because speed limits are established to ensure safety on the roads. These limits are set based on a variety of factors including road conditions, traffic patterns, and safety considerations. Exceeding these limits increases the risk of accidents, reduces the driver's ability to react to unexpected situations, and contributes to more severe outcomes in the event of a crash. Compliance with speed limits is essential for maintaining order and safety in traffic flow, making this action a direct violation of established traffic control measures. On the other hand, stopping at a red light and yielding to pedestrians are examples of following traffic control laws, while using turn signals correctly also reflects responsible and legal driving behavior.
